Game + short movie = fantastic combination
I love the bizarre, surreal world of the free Cube Escape series. It’s all about atmosphere and mystery. Inspired by Twin Peaks. A cubelike room or set of rooms. Psychological horror. Dark humor. Strange creatures. An overarching story about a mysterious murder (or was it suicide…) First-person, but the protagonist is not always the same character. Inventory objects + stand-alone puzzles. Recurring themes, characters, objects. Changing the past and/or the future. Every game adds new elements to the Rusty Lake universe.
Paradox is the tenth game in the series and this time the developers added a short 18-minute movie. Scenes from the film are integrated in the game and vice versa. It also contains hints for extra achievements and secret endings. Very well done.
The surrealistic world of Cube Escape allows you to jump right in, although you will of course miss references to previous games. Highly recommended. The first chapter and the movie are both free; the second chapter is only a few dollars.
